Jazz Pharmaceuticals (JAZZ) has announced the acquisition of Chimerix for $8.55 per share, representing a total cash consideration of $935 million - a 72% premium over Chimerix's closing price on March 4, 2025. The transaction is expected to close in Q2 2025.

The acquisition centers on dordaviprone, Chimerix's lead clinical asset, a first-in-class treatment for H3 K27M-mutant diffuse glioma, a rare brain tumor affecting children and young adults. The FDA has granted Priority Review for dordaviprone with a PDUFA date of August 18, 2025. If approved, it would be the first FDA-approved therapy specifically for this condition.

The drug is also being evaluated in the ongoing Phase 3 ACTION trial for newly diagnosed patients. Jazz plans to leverage its development and commercial capabilities for a potential launch in the second half of 2025, with patent protection extending to 2037.

DUBLIN and DURHAM, N.C., March 5,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Jazz Pharmaceuticals plc (Nasdaq: JAZZ) ("Jazz" or the "Company") and Chimerix (Nasdaq: CMRX) ("Chimerix"), today announced the companies have entered into a definitive agreement for Jazz to acquire Chimerix for $8.55 per share in cash, representing a total consideration of approximately $935 million. The transaction has been approved by both companies and is expected to close in the second quarter of 2025.

Chimerix's lead clinical asset is dordaviprone, a novel first-in-class small molecule treatment in development for H3 K27M-mutant diffuse glioma, a rare, high-grade brain tumor that most commonly affects children and young adults. There are no U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A)-approved therapies specifically for H3 K27M-mutant diffuse glioma patients; radiation is the most common treatment approach. A New Drug Application (NDA) for accelerated approval of dordaviprone in recurrent H3 K27M-mutant diffuse glioma was recently accepted and granted Priority Review by FDA. FDA has set a target Prescription Drug User Fee Act (PDUFA) action date of August 18, 2025. If approved in the U.S., dordaviprone may be eligible for a Rare Pediatric Disease Priority Review Voucher (PRV). Separately, dordaviprone is being studied in the ongoing Phase 3 ACTION trial, evaluating its use in newly diagnosed, non-recurrent H3 K27M-mutant diffuse glioma patients following radiation treatment, potentially extending this treatment option into the front-line setting.

Transaction Terms
Under the terms of the merger agreement, Jazz will commence an all-cash tender offer to acquire all outstanding shares of Chimerix's common stock, whereby Chimerix shareholders will be offered $8.55 per share in cash, representing a total consideration of approximately $935 million. This reflects an approximately 72% premium based on the closing trading price on March 4, 2025. Upon the successful completion of the tender offer, Jazz will acquire all shares not acquired in the tender through a second-step merger for the same consideration per share paid in the tender offer.

Jazz expects to fund the transaction through existing cash and investments.

Closing Conditions
The transaction is subject to customary closing conditions, including the tender of a majority of the outstanding shares of Chimerix's voting common stock and other conditions. Chimerix's Board of Directors unanimously recommends that Chimerix shareholders tender their shares in the tender offer.

About Dordaviprone
Dordaviprone (ONC201) is a novel first-in-class small molecule imipridone that selectively targets the mitochondrial protease ClpP and dopamine receptor D2 (DRD2). Dordaviprone's unique mechanism of action includes alterations of key epigenetic modifications such as reversal of H3 K27me3-loss, which is the hallmark of H3 K27M-mutant gliomas.
